    This demonstration clip runs for fifteen (15) minutes. It is designed to intimate you with the format of the Test you wish to take. It will help you to become more familiar with the questions and contents of the PTDF internet-based test.

    Being an internet-based test, it is time-bound. Once you commence, the timer is activated and at the expiration of the time allowed for the part of the test you chose, you will be logged out and not given access to questions in that part again.



    You can view all the questions in any part of the test by using the TAKE TEST button. This allows you to answer the questions in any order that is convenient for you.



    If you are able to answer all the questions in any part before the expiration of the time allowed for it, you can review your previous answers by clicking the REVIEW button, or at any other time during the period allowed for that part of the test. If you are satisfied with your work before the expiration of the time allocated for any part of the test, you may submit your answers by clicking on SUBMIT button. If you are not able to finish the test before you are logged out, the system will automatically submit on your behalf the answers you have provided during the course of the examination.







    This test comprises two parts, PARTS I & II.



    PART I: GENERAL PAPER TIME ALLOWED: 5 MINUTES



    This is the general paper. There are ten (10) questions and you are provided with five (5) multiple choice answers for each one. Click on what you consider to be the correct answer to each question.

    You are required to attempt all questions. However, you are advised not to make guesses at the answers to the questions since you will lose as many marks for an incorrect answer as you will score for a correct answer.

    Time allowed is Five (5) minutes.





    PART II: TECHNICAL COMPETENCE. TIME ALLOWED: 10 MINUTES



    This part is designed to assess your technical competence.

    Table 1 is a list of courses for which scholarships are available and they have been grouped into sixteen (16) sections; Sections A, B, C, D, E, F, G, H, I, J, K, L, M, N, O, and P.

    STUDY THIS TABLE CAREFULLY and from it, CHOOSE ONE SECTION ONLY, that is related to your area of expertise and for which you are seeking an overseas scholarship. Please note that once you have chosen a section and logged onto it, the system will not allow you to choose any other section, i.e., you will not be in a position to change your mind and seek your fortune in another section. So you are advised to CAREFULLY and THOUGHTFULLY make your choice.



    You are required to attempt all the questions in the section you have chosen. There are five (5) questions and you are provided with five (5) multiple choice answers for each one. Click on what you consider to be the correct answer to each question. There is no penalty for wrong answers.

    Time allowed is Ten (10) minutes.
